How this program handles evaluation and governance
Trainers are assessed on whether they teach the evaluation and governance modules properly, not just the build modules. Those are the ones most often skipped for time, and skipping them removes the reason the curriculum exists.

Do we get the materials permanently?
You get a licence to deliver them while the partnership is active, with updates.
How many trainers per institution?
Usually two to four. One is fragile; more than four dilutes consistency.
